Climbing 'Seitenwind' (literally 'Sidewind') in the Vienna Woods is a classic experience. The route, graded 6- (UIAA), offers a pleasant challenge for intermediate climbers. The rock is generally solid limestone, providing good friction and varied holds. You'll find a mix of crimps, edges, and sometimes surprisingly large pockets. The exposure can be a factor, especially higher up, but the views of the surrounding forest are rewarding. The route is relatively well-protected with bolts, making it a good option for climbers looking to push their grade in a safe and scenic environment. Be aware that 'Seitenwind', as its name suggests, can be quite breezy, adding an extra element to the climb. Overall, it's a highly recommended route that combines enjoyable climbing with the natural beauty of the Wienerwald.
